The virtual asset market is continuing a strong upward rally, breaking the $80,000 mark, driven by record institutional capital inflows into Bitcoin (BTC) spot ETFs and the easing of geopolitical risks.
According to the cryptocurrency media outlet BeInCrypto on May 5 (local time), the total cryptocurrency market capitalization increased by $17.14 billion from Sunday's close, reaching $2.63 trillion, a 0.66% rise. It has shown a steady recovery since hitting a low of $2.48 trillion on April 29, with $2.64 trillion currently acting as a short-term resistance level.
Notably, on May 1 alone, US Bitcoin spot ETFs absorbed $573.28 million, the largest amount since January, setting a new multi-month record.
Institutional capital has rotated back into the cryptocurrency market as Donald Trump's Project Freedom, a plan to escort ships through the Strait of Hormuz announced on May 4, eased oil supply pressures. Bitcoin is currently trading at $80,405, maintaining a stable trend within a parallel ascending channel that has driven its price since late March. The Chaikin Money Flow (CMF) indicator, which reflects institutional buying pressure, registered 0.11, showing an upward trend and indicating that this rebound is not merely a temporary phenomenon driven by news but is supported by a solid institutional foundation.
If Bitcoin breaks above $82,139, it is expected to rise through $83,846 and $86,277, potentially reaching the extended upper trendline of the channel at $89,372. Currently, $80,432 acts as an immediate resistance level, while downside support is established at $78,320 and $74,906. If the total market capitalization forms a daily close above $2.64 trillion, further upside towards $2.73 trillion is possible, but a break below $2.58 trillion could intensify downward pressure towards $2.48 trillion.
Toncoin (TON) surged approximately 30% in 24 hours to $1.744 after Telegram founder Pavel Durov announced a six-fold reduction in transaction fees and Telegram joining as the largest validator. The fee reduction is expected to create an environment where Telegram's 950 million users can utilize micro-payments on the blockchain without the burden of fees. If Toncoin surpasses the $1.79 resistance level, it could continue its rally to $1.94, but failure to break through this zone could lead to a price correction down to the $1.52 level.
